When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Clayton?
Good weather’s definitely a plus when you’re experiencing new places, so here’s some information that may be helpful: The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 66°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 26°F. The snowiest months in Clayton are January, February, March, and November, with each month seeing an average of 18 inches of snowfall.
What is there to see and do in Clayton?
Overall, Clayton is known for its rivers, coffee shops, and boating opportunities. Get out into nature with places like Lake Ontario, Cedar Point State Park, and Grenell Island. Cultural attractions include Antique Boat Museum, The Clayton Opera House, and Thousand Islands Museum. Locals like to shop at 1000 Islands River Rat Cheese.
What's the best way to get to and around Clayton while staying at a hostel?
Keep this information about transit options in and around Clayton in your back pocket to make the most of your stay: You can search for flights to the closest airport, which is Watertown, NY (ART-Watertown Intl.), 17.2 mi (27.6 km) away from the city center. An alternative is Kingston, ON (YGK-Norman Rogers), which is 25.4 mi (40.8 km) away.
